Global Pet Films Market (USD Million), 2021 - 2031

In the year 2024, the Global Pet Films Market was valued at USD 5353.26 million. The size of this market is expected to increase to USD 7532.57 million by the year 2031, while growing at a Compounded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 5.0%.

The Global Pet Films Market has been experiencing significant growth over the past few years, driven by increasing demand from various end-use industries such as packaging, electronics, and healthcare. Polyethylene terephthalate (PET) films are highly valued for their excellent mechanical, thermal, and chemical properties, making them ideal for a wide range of applications. The market is characterized by rapid technological advancements, which have led to the development of innovative products with enhanced functionalities. These advancements, coupled with the rising need for sustainable and recyclable materials, are propelling the market forward.

A key factor contributing to the expansion of the PET films market is the robust growth of the packaging industry. PET films are extensively used in food and beverage packaging due to their superior barrier properties, which help in extending the shelf life of products. Additionally, the increasing consumer preference for convenient and lightweight packaging solutions has further boosted the demand for PET films. The market is also benefiting from the growing e-commerce sector, where the need for durable and protective packaging materials is paramount. This surge in demand from various sectors underscores the importance of PET films in modern packaging solutions.

The electronics and healthcare industries are significantly contributing to the growth of the PET films market. In the electronics sector, PET films are used in applications such as flexible printed circuits, displays, and photovoltaic panels, thanks to their excellent insulating properties and durability. In the healthcare sector, PET films are utilized in medical packaging and diagnostic devices, where their clarity, strength, and chemical resistance are crucial. The ongoing research and development activities aimed at improving the performance of PET films and expanding their application scope are expected to create new growth opportunities for the market in the coming years.
